| Chigusa: Alright, so why is it important to know your reason for learning? |
| Yuriy: Great question. Listeners, more often than not, your reason is directly related to your goal... |
| Chigusa: Like... “I want to live in the country where the language is spoken.” |
| Yuriy: ...or “I want to understand the culture, movies, and music.” |
| Chigusa: But it can also be something simple like... “I’m just interested in it.” |
| Yuriy: Exactly. But the point is, if you know your reason... |
| Chigusa: ...You’ll always remember what got you started in the first place. |
| Yuriy: And as a result, you’ll maintain your motivation and keep going. |
| Chigusa: Now, what about sharing your reason with others? |
| Yuriy: By the way, I don’t mean bragging about goals like “I’ll be fluent in 10 months.” But rather… “I’m learning because…of this and that.” Real reasons. |
| Chigusa: I see. So why share this with others? |
| Yuriy: When you talk about your reason for learning with others, you remind yourself indirectly. |
| Chigusa: Ah, okay, it’ll always be on top of your mind. |
| Yuriy: So the more you think about it, the more likely you are to do it. |
| Chigusa: Plus, you set an expectation. Your friends now see you as someone who’s actively learning a language… |
| Yuriy: ...and that’s another powerful motivator. Also, you convince yourself that you can and will learn the language. |
| Chigusa: Ah, that’s a good point. A lot of people think they can’t learn a language… |
| Yuriy: Yeah, they think they don’t have the time for it... or the talent for it. |
| Chigusa: But in reality, all you need is the confidence to just start |
| Yuriy: So, by talking about your reason, you also convince yourself that you can do it. |

| Chigusa: We’ve asked. Here are the Top 10 Reasons for Learning a Language. |
| Yuriy: Number One: I love the culture and the people who speak the language. |
| Chigusa: This is a popular answer, especially amongst our Japanese and Korean learners. |
| Yuriy: Number Two: I want to understand songs, movies, and TV shows. Also a very popular reason! |
| Chigusa: That’s right. And listeners – songs, movies, and shows are great ways to immerse yourself in the language! |
| Yuriy: If you’re spending your time learning AND also immersing yourself, you’re guaranteed to learn faster. |
| Chigusa: Number Three: It's a beautiful language. |
| Yuriy: You know, sometimes, an answer as simple as that is good enough. |
| Chigusa: Yeah, it means you have a genuine interest in the language itself. |
| Yuriy: Number Four: My family comes from a place where the language is spoken. |
| Chigusa: The fifth one is similar: I want to speak to my partner's family in their language. |
| Yuriy: The sixth one is kind of similar: I am learning the language to impress someone. |
| Chigusa: Listeners, are you learning a language to impress or talk to someone special? |
| Yuriy: That’s definitely a powerful motivator. The seventh one is... Ah, this one, you should say... |
| Chigusa: Yes, yes, yes, please let me say it! I love traveling! |
| Yuriy: Number Eight: I live... or... want to live in a country that speaks the language. |
| Chigusa: Number Nine: I just love learning languages! |
| Yuriy: What’s great about this is...if you’ve learned one language... some say, it’s EASIER to learn another. |
| Chigusa: Because you learn HOW to learn a language, right? |
| Yuriy: Exactly, Chigusa. If you learn one, you develop the habits and know-how to master another. |
| Chigusa: And the last one, Number Ten: It’s just a personal goal. |
| Yuriy: We hear this a lot. Especially from learners that stopped, took a break… and came back. |
| Chigusa: Yeah, if you have a goal in mind, something you wanted to do, but never did... |
| Yuriy: ...you want to come back to it and get it done. So, Chigusa, I think most people learn for love, for family… |
| Chigusa: ...traveling or self improvement! |
